Following up on a similar variety erroneously produced in 1998, some 1999-S Lincoln proof cents were struck using the 1999 business-strike reverse die, showing the bases of the letters A and M in the word AMERICA nearly touching each other. This error can be seen with the naked eye and has become very popular with Lincoln cent enthusiasts. While it is unknown exactly how many exist, it is certainly a scarce error that realizes easily hundreds of dollars apiece, with some better examples taking thousands.

Obverse Description

Bust of Abraham Lincoln framed by IN GOD WE TRUST on the top periphery. The word LIBERTY to the left of the portait and the date postioned on the right side.

Reverse Description

Lincoln memorial building centered with words ONE CENT, UNITED STATES OF AMERICA on top and bottom periphery. E PLURIBUS UNUM centered above the top of the memorial.
